Microsoft 365 (Office)

Microsoft 365 (formerly Office 365) is a subscription service from Microsoft that includes access to popular Office apps like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ook. It also includes cloud services like OneDrive storage and Skype messaging.

EuroOffice

EuroOffice is an open-source office suite that provides similar functionality to Microsoft Office. It includes a word processor, spreadsheet, presentation tool, and more with basic editing and formatting features comparable to Office.
